As women age, their bodies go through changes that can make it more difficult to lose weight. For many women over the age of 55, taking weight-loss pills may seem like an attractive option. But are these pills safe and effective for older women?
There is no “magic bullet” when it comes to weight loss, and that includes weight-loss pills. Many of these products are not regulated by the FDA, so it’s difficult to know what you’re getting. And even if a pill is approved by the FDA, that doesn’t mean it’s necessarily safe or effective.
Weight-loss pills can have side effects, especially for older women. These can include high blood pressure, heart palpitations, and anxiety. Some of these products also contain stimulants like caffeine, which can cause insomnia and irritability.

The strongest weight loss prescription pill is Phentermine. It is a Schedule IV drug and is only available with a doctor’s prescription. Phentermine acts as an appetite suppressant by stimulating the release of norepinephrine, a neurotransmitter that signals a fight-or-flight response in the body.
This increases heart rate and blood pressure while also suppressing appetite. While Phentermine is effective for short-term weight loss, it can be addictive and has potential side effects such as dry mouth, insomnia, anxiety, and irritability.

It is no secret that as we age, our metabolism slows down and it becomes harder to lose weight. But why is this? And why does it seem to be more difficult for women than men?
There are a few reasons for this. First, after the age of 30, we begin to lose muscle mass. This is because our bodies start to produce less testosterone, which is responsible for muscle growth.
Second, our bodies become more efficient at storing fat. So even if we are eating the same amount of calories as we were in our 20s, we are likely to gain weight because our bodies are holding on to more fat. Third, hormonal changes can lead to an increase in appetite and cravings, making it even harder to stick to a healthy diet.
Finally, as we age, our cells become less sensitive to insulin (the hormone that helps regulate blood sugar), which can lead to Type 2 diabetes and further contribute to weight gain.
